워드프레스는 댓글 기능을 기본으로 제공하기 때문에, 스팸 댓글이 많아질 경우 단순히 보기만 불편한 수준을 넘어 검색엔진 최적화(SEO), 신뢰도, 보안까지 악영향을 줄 수 있습니다.
스팸을 방치할 때 어떤 문제가 발생하며, 이를 어떻게 차단해야 하는지 단계별로 이해해 봅시다.
📉 1. 스팸 댓글이 SEO에 미치는 대표적 영향
✔ ① 검색엔진 신뢰도 하락
스팸 댓글은 보통 무의미한 텍스트나 광고성 링크를 포함하며, 이런 콘텐츠가 페이지에 많이 노출되면 검색엔진이 페이지 품질을 낮게 판단할 수 있습니다.
이는 검색 결과의 순위 저하로 이어질 위험이 존재합니다.
✔ ② 페이지 체류 시간 및 UX 하락
스팸 댓글이 많으면 사용자가 답을 찾기 어렵고, 콘텐츠가 산만해져 체류시간이 줄고 이탈률이 높아질 가능성이 큽니다. 이는 SEO 평가지표에 부정적인 영향을 미칩니다.
✔ ③ 악성 코드·보안 리스크
일부 스팸 댓글에는 악성 링크나 피싱 유도 URL이 포함되어 있어 보안 사고 및 안전한 브라우징 경험 저해로 이어질 수 있으며, 이러한 페이지는 검색 엔진에서 불이익을 받을 수 있습니다.
✔ ④ 애드센스·광고 정책 위반 위험
구글 AdSense 등 광고 플랫폼 정책에서는 악성 링크·스팸 페이지 내 광고를 허용하지 않습니다. 스팸 댓글이 방치되면 광고 계정 심사에도 불리하게 작용할 수 있습니다.
🛡 2. 스팸 댓글이 발생하는 원인
- 자동화된 봇이 댓글 폼을 무차별로 공격
- 오래된 게시물 · 활성 모니터링 부재
- 기본 설정으로 COMMENT MODERATION을 하지 않은 경우
스팸은 단순히 무의미한 메시지뿐 아니라 키워드·링크 스팸 형태로 검색 엔진을 속이려는 의도로 남겨지기도 합니다. 이런 형태는 ‘스팸덱싱(spamdexing)’으로 불리는 SEO 조작 기법과 연결되기도 합니다.
🧰 3. 워드프레스 스팸 댓글 예방 및 차단 전략
1) 코어 설정으로 스팸 완화
👉 설정 → 토론(Discussion) 메뉴로 이동하여 아래 옵션을 활성화합니다:
✔ 댓글 작성자가 이름/이메일을 필수 입력하도록 설정
✔ 댓글은 관리자가 승인해야 표시 설정
✔ “X개 이상의 링크 포함 댓글은 승인 대기” 옵션 설정
→ 간단한 설정만으로도 스팸의 대부분을 자동 필터링할 수 있습니다.
2) 댓글 자동차단·스팸 필터 플러그인 사용
📌 대표 플러그인
✔ Akismet Anti-Spam – 워드프레스 기본 제공 스팸 필터 (설치 후 API 키 등록 필요)
✔ Antispam Bee – 개인정보 걱정 없이 스팸 차단 가능
✔ WP Armour – 보이지 않는 CAPTCHA 기술로 봇 차단
Akismet은 전 세계 WordPress 사이트에서 축적된 스팸 데이터를 기반으로 자동 분류하기 때문에 높은 정확도를 제공합니다.
3) CAPTCHA / 폼 보호 도입
스팸 봇은 자동화된 절차로 댓글을 삽입합니다.
👉 구글 reCAPTCHA나 hCaptcha 등의 테스트를 추가하면 봇 차단에 큰 효과가 있습니다.
4) 링크 제한 및 블랙리스트 설정
스팸 댓글 범죄의 많은 부분은 불필요한 링크 삽입입니다.
👉 댓글 설정에서 “허용 링크 개수 제한” 또는 특정 URL/IP를 블랙리스트에 추가하면 스팸을 효과적으로 줄일 수 있습니다.
5) 오래된 게시물 댓글 자동 닫기
스팸봇은 관리하기 어려운 오래된 페이지를 자주 타깃으로 합니다.
👉 댓글 작성 허용 기간을 X일로 제한해 주요 글만 인터랙션을 허용하는 것도 효과적인 전략입니다.
6) 트랙백 및 핑백 비활성화
트랙백/핑백은 외부 링크를 알리는 통지 기능이지만, 많은 경우 스팸 링크 유입 채널로 악용됩니다.
👉 불필요하다면 완전히 비활성화하는 것이 좋습니다.
⚡ 4. 스팸 댓글 관련 SEO 최적화 팁
✔ nofollow 설정
댓글 내 링크에는 nofollow 속성을 부여해 검색 엔진이 해당 링크를 추적하지 않도록 합니다.
이는 스팸 링크가 SEO 가중치에 영향을 주지 않도록 돕는 중요한 설정입니다.
📌 5. 모니터링 & 유지관리
스팸은 한 번 설정해놓고 끝나는 문제가 아닙니다.
✔ 정기적으로 댓글을 검토
✔ 스팸 패턴이 바뀌면 필터 목록 업데이트
✔ 플러그인 업데이트 및 보안 점검
→ 이렇게 적극적으로 관리하면 스팸이 쌓이지 않고, SEO·브랜드 신뢰도를 유지할 수 있습니다.
🧠 스팸 댓글에 대응해야 하는 이유
스팸 댓글은 단순한 번거로운 메시지가 아닙니다.
✔ 검색엔진 평가에 부정적 영향을 주고
✔ 사용자 경험을 떨어뜨리며
✔ 보안과 광고 정책 리스크를 높일 수 있습니다.
이를 막기 위해서는 기본 설정 + 자동 스팸 필터 + 추가 CAPTCHA/블랙리스트를 결합한 다층 방어 전략을 구축하는 것이 효과적입니다.